This is a regular stop of mine, cheap, cheerful with the type of atmosphere that encourages you to linger reading a book for hours on end nursing a cup of tea. The downside is that service is slow. The upside is their excellent value cheese plate for €5, they also do a happy hour 6-7 daily, with every glass of wine you get a few tapas style nibbles. The fact that it is open till around 2am is a huge bonus, the one place in Galway where you can enjoy a cup of hot chocolate after a night out!
